Runbook 7.3 — Account Recovery (Slimshift image pipeline)

If the build account for the container-slimming service is locked after a failed rotation, restore access as follows: verify the last good image digest, disable auto-rotation, and initiate recovery from the offline bundle. The bundle prompts once for credentials. Enter the recovery passphrase shown below.

recovery phrase for yageg-fahag: casax-briiel-novath-casdor-belax-istath-fenir-briath-druius-novael

Handover Note — Director Transition, Brindlewood Kitchenware Line

To the incoming heads of department: pricing on the Brindlewood range was last reviewed in spring, when we held the mid-tier at a 38% margin despite rising enamel costs. Distributors in Carthbury have been pressing for volume discounts; I resisted pending the autumn demand data. Review the elasticity study before conceding anything. The context below should inform your first pricing committee, so read it carefully.

internal memo for kaduf-baduf: Only 35 of the 378 pilot accounts renewed Holir, so a churn review is set for June 11. Eliielax Group is in early talks to buy Silaelix Group for about $142.1 million.

Customer-Support Outsourcing Plan — Managers Only

Proposal: transfer tier-one support for the Lanterna suite to the Korbett Services centre in Dunhollow. Projected annual saving: eighteen percent of support costs. Transition window: two quarters, with parallel running in month one. Finance to model severance and contract costs. The strategic basis is noted below.

internal memo for faweg-tafog: Only 7 of the 100 pilot accounts renewed Quenael, so a churn review is set for April 15.

Q3 Planning — Loyalty Overhaul

Heads of department: the Spindle Rewards revamp ships in phases. Phase one: tier restructure and points devaluation. Phase two: partner integration with Corvane Markets. Budgets frozen until sign-off. Staffing asks due Friday. Comms embargoed until launch week. Direction for the programme's commercial positioning is summarised in the confidential note below.

internal memo for kawip-hadug: Headcount on the Wenwyn team goes from 7 to 140 by the end of January. Gross margin on Wenwyn came in at 20 percent against a plan of 15 percent.